Leeds United secured a much-needed victory on Sunday afternoon, as Thomas Christiansen’s men ran out 2-1 winners over Middlesbrough at Elland Road.

Victory ensured the Whites ended a run of three straight defeats, providing their Danish boss with a much-needed reprieve in the midst of minor uncertainty surrounding his future.

Leeds are now level on points with sixth-placed Boro, but face a tough trip to league leaders Wolves in the week as they look to back up their win with a positive display.

West Yorkshire Sport posed the question to fans on Twitter as to whether the positive result against former boss Garry Monk’s side marked a turning point in their season, with many fans sceptical to brand the three points as this at this early stage.

The result certainly puts Leeds back on track following a dismal run of form, but with Wolves on the horizon, many were reluctant to get too excited following the weekend’s result…
